Enrique Tizon 2022 speaker

Enrique Tizon is a seasoned Syndications Officer currently covering IFC syndicated lending across sectors, exclusively, in SSA. During his 12-year tenure at IFC he has covered IFC syndicated transactions in Asia based in Hong Kong, Latam based in Washington DC and more recently the larger EMEA region while based in London.
